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3688597 8757597 6214586 70769258
370771 56154164366
370771 56154164366
43866 8882 21
All about undefined
Interested in learning more?
370771 56154164366
43866 8882 21
See more
93145 100593047
46312553 65390817 479585461 6166092361
See more
9647369 642 5620841036
21 9814883 288
See more